"Mother Earth, Vol. 1 No. 6, August 1906-Various" presents a collection of writings that delve into the social and political issues of the early 20th century, reflecting on the struggles for justice and equality. This volume captures the spirit of its time, addressing themes of labor rights, social reform, and the human connection to the environment, all of which remain relevant today as we continue to grapple with similar challenges. The essays and articles offer a profound exploration of the human condition and the quest for a better society, making it a timeless resource for those interested in the roots of modern activism.
